'Jordan is Beautiful' campaign launched
By By Khetam Malkawi AMMAN - Jordanians planning to spend their vacations in the country can avail of discounted offers at tourism sites across the Kingdom under the "Jordan is Beautiful" campaign that was launched on Monday.Organised by the Ministry of Tourism and Antiquities in cooperation with the Federation of Tourism Associations, the campaign will provide offers all year-round, according to Minister of Tourism and Antiquities Haifa Abu Ghazaleh.
She said the campaign provides 26 programmes with the aim of promoting domestic tourism and encouraging Jordanians to spend their holidays in the Kingdom.
At a press conference yesterday to announce the launch of the campaign, Ministry of Tourism Secretary General Issa Gammoh noted that the programmes will be reviewed every two months and a new list of programmes will be announced.
"We want to establish an administration to run tourism sites through conducting surveys to define the required services at each site to be implemented through investors," he said.
Gammoh explained that investments will be open to interested local, Arab and foreign investors.
Meanwhile, Shafiq Hayek, head of the Tourist Transportation Association, said the association is committed to providing sufficient means of transport for the campaign.
He noted that in case of any shortage due to outbound tourism, the association will rent vehicles from other companies.
Also yesterday, Jordan Tourism Board Director General Nayef Fayez said programmes tailored to promote Jordan as a tourism destination will be launched in Arab states next month.
The Cabinet has recently approved a decision under which Arab tourists will pay the same entry fee for tourism sites as Jordanians.
